MAIN PURPOSE OF THE JOB:
Lead the protection and enhancement of the company’s reputation and license to operate through high-level pro-active stakeholder engagement, representing the company externally in matters relevant to the business and effectively communicating the company’s contributions to society.
Translate external expectations to what that means for the business, providing the businesses an outside perspective and anticipate and manage issues at the same time unlock growth opportunities in the company’s value chain helping link value for brands and building brands with purpose.
MAIN R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Identify and monitor external public affairs issues which influence public perceptions of Nestle and/or the development of issues affecting the company, and where appropriate, develop or strengthen strategic relations with selected organizations.
- Protect the interests of NPI which may be affected by proposed legislative and/or regulatory issues.
- Maintain compliance with applicable government rules and regulations affecting the manufacture, sale and distribution of NPI products.
- Provide critical counsel, leadership and strategic action plans and communication input on regulatory and public affairs issues that could impact on corporate reputation.
- Conceptualize, design and implement relevant CSV programs to support the Nestle Mission and Vision.
- Represent the interests of the company in industry organizations.
- Provide advice as a thought partner subject matter and process expert in the field of social development and external stakeholder relations
KEY QUALIFICATIONS:
- Degree level education with strong preference on JD and bar passers
- At least 12 years experience in social development with some business/ private sector, stakeholder engagement/ public relations and government relations
- Experience in effective networking, communicating and influencing, and advocating to top level executives, industry and government
- Experience of senior-level negotiations and conflict management
- Excellent network of contacts with government, NGOs, KOLs, private businesses
- Recognized solid project management and interrelation skills.
- Experience in building and implementing strategy
- Able to work under stress and stay calm in crisis situation, able to work fast
- Good level of knowledge and understanding of the use of information technology and media
